Henry Corbin (1903-1978), who radically renewed Islamic studies, in particular Iranian and mystical studies, is a multifaceted thinker and still too little known. First translator in France of Heidegger, he drew from the sources of "prophetic philosophy" a rich and profound thought which deserves its place alongside the greatest systems. Daryush Shayegan, himself Iranian and who was his pupil, delivers here the first complete synthesis of his work. Metaphysics of the imagination, prophecy and initiation, Shî'ism, Ismailism, Avicenna, Mollâ Sadrâ, Sohrawardî, angelology, theophany, religion of love ... so many themes that draw a spiritual landscape full of promises for contemporary reflection and where a real dialogue between West and East can begin.
Authors biography
Daryush Shayegan, former director of the Iranian Center for the Study of Civilizations, is notably the author, with Albin Michel, of Cultural Schizophrenia: Islamic Societies in the Face of Modernity.
